Oregon’s coastal weather can change quickly; layering helps you stay comfortable throughout your trip.
The boat deck can be wet and slippery, so sturdy, non-slip shoes are crucial for safety.
If you're prone to seasickness, bring medication or natural remedies to ensure comfort on the water.
Use waterproof bags or cases to shield your camera, phone, and other electronics from splashes.
